Despite its widespread use, many professionals encounter challenges when first engaging with Photoshop due to its complexity and the steep learning curve associated with mastering its features. Common gaps include misunderstanding layer functionality, struggling with non-destructive editing techniques, or failing to optimize workflows for efficiency. These obstacles often result in subpar outputs or inefficient processes, which can hinder both individual performance and organizational goals. A notable example of Photoshop’s impact can be seen in the fashion industry, where brands like Gucci and Nike frequently utilize edited visuals to craft aspirational narratives. Behind every striking advertisement lies meticulous work involving color correction, compositing, and typography—all achievable through Photoshop. Similarly, photographers rely on the software to transform raw captures into stunning final products, as demonstrated by renowned photographer Annie Leibovitz, whose iconic portraits often undergo post-processing refinement. These examples underscore the versatility and indispensability of Photoshop across creative disciplines.
Beyond aesthetics, Photoshop plays a critical role in emerging trends such as augmented reality (AR) and virtual reality (VR), where realistic textures and environments are essential components. As industries increasingly adopt immersive technologies, professionals skilled in image manipulation will find themselves at the forefront of innovation. Furthermore, advancements in artificial intelligence within Photoshop, such as neural filters and automated selections, highlight the evolving nature of the tool and the need for continuous skill development to stay competitive.
